Abstract

A simple, efficient, and new method has been developed for the synthesis of isothiocyanates from amines. The reaction of a variety of aromatic and aliphatic amines with carbon disulfide in the presence of diethyl chlorophosphate as an efficient reagent proceeded effectively to afford the corresponding isothiocyanates in moderate yields. This method is easy, rapid, and moderate-yielding for the synthesis of isothiocyanates from amines.
